Message type: E = Error
Message class: GA - Allocations
Message number: 824
Message text: Cycle run group & was successfully deleted.

- Cycle run group & was successfully deleted. ?The SAP error message GA824 indicates that a cycle run group was successfully deleted. This message is not necessarily an error but rather an informational message indicating that a specific cycle run group has been removed from the system.
Cause:
The message GA824 is triggered when a user or a process attempts to delete a cycle run group in the SAP system, and the deletion is successful. This could happen for various reasons, such as:
- User Action: A user manually deleted the cycle run group through the SAP GUI.
- System Process: A background job or automated process that manages cycle run groups may have deleted it as part of its operation.
- Data Cleanup: Regular maintenance or data cleanup activities may have led to the deletion of unused or obsolete cycle run groups.
Solution:
Since GA824 is an informational message, there is no direct "solution" required unless the deletion was unintentional. Here are some steps you can take if you need to address the situation:
- Verify Deletion: Check if the deletion of the cycle run group was intended. If it was not, you may need to recreate the cycle run group.
- Recreate Cycle Run Group: If the deletion was unintentional, you can recreate the cycle run group using the appropriate transaction code (e.g., transaction code KSV1 for creating cycle run groups).
- Check Dependencies: Ensure that the deletion of the cycle run group does not affect any ongoing processes or reports that rely on it.
- Audit Logs: Review system logs or change logs to identify who or what process initiated the deletion, especially if it was unexpected.
